Bishop Burbidge Announces Three Pastoral Appointments

larger font

Most Reverend Michael F. Burbidge, Bishop of Raleigh, announces the following Priest assisgnments:

Effective July 8, 2008

Reverend Carlos N. Arce, Administrator of Saint Andrew Mission, Red Springs, is appointed full-time Vicar for Hispanics with residence at Saint Michael the Archangel Rectory in Cary.

Very Reverend James F. Garneau, V.F., Pastor of Saint Mary Parish, Mount Olive, and Dean of the Newton Grove Deanery, is additionally appointed Diocesan Director of the Office of the Permanent Diaconate.

Reverend Patrick Keane, is appointed Pastor of Our Lady of Guadalupe Parish in Newton Grove.

Bishop Burbidge expresses his gratitude for the generous priestly ministry of The Reverend Monsignor Michael G. Clay as Director of the Office of the Permanent Diaconate and The Very Reverend Patrick Keane as Vicar for Hispanics.
